What they do

A Civil Engineering Manager oversees engineering and technical design of civil engineering projects, such as infrastructure and buildings. Manages communication and coordination among different types of engineers working on a project. Supervises project schedule, budget, and communications with stakeholders.

Position Overview:
We are seeking a Traveling Project Manager•Civil to lead and deliver civil construction projects across multiple regional sites. This role is responsible for on-site project leadership, schedule and budget management, quality assurance, and ensuring safe, compliant execution of earthwork, utilities, water systems, and grading scopes. The successful candidate will travel frequently to project locations, coordinate subcontractors and crews, and act as the primary point of contact for owners and stakeholders to ensure projects are completed on time and within budget.
Key Responsibilities:
Provide on-site project management and leadership for multiple civil construction projects across varying locations Develop, maintain and drive project schedules, milestones and critical path activities to meet contractual commitments Manage project budgets, cost tracking, forecasting and implement cost-control measures Coordinate, supervise and schedule subcontractors, vendors and project crews to optimize productivity and resource utilization Oversee earthwork operations, grading, utility installations and water-related construction to ensure compliance with plans and specifications Ensure quality assurance/quality control processes are followed and perform periodic inspections to verify construction conformance Enforce and promote strict adherence to safety policies, site-specific safety plans and regulatory requirements Serve as primary client/stakeholder liaison, providing regular progress updates, managing expectations and resolving issues quickly Prepare and maintain project documentation including daily reports, RFIs, submittals, change orders and as-built records Identify risks, develop mitigation plans and lead change management efforts to minimize impacts to schedule and budget Plan and manage logistics for travel, site mobilization, equipment and material deliveries Mentor and develop junior field staff and encourage a collaborative, solutions-focused team environment
Qualifications:
Bachelors degree in Civil Engineering, Construction Management or related field, or equivalent experience Minimum 5 years of progressive project management experience in civil construction with demonstrated success managing earthwork, utilities, water and grading scopes Proven ability to manage multiple projects and frequent travel (typically 50% or more) with flexible availability to be on-site as needed Strong knowledge of construction methods, reading plans/specifications, construction QA/QC and permitting requirements Experience with project scheduling and cost-control tools (e.g., MS Project, Primavera, Procore or similar) Excellent leadership, communication and client relationship skills with experience coordinating subcontractors and interdisciplinary teams Certified Project Management Professional (PMP), Certified Construction Manager (CCM) or equivalent is a plus OSHA 10 or 30-hour safety certification preferred Valid drivers license and ability to travel and work extended hours on-site; must be able to pass background check and drug screening if required Problem-solving mindset with strong organizational skills and attention to detail Benefits Medical Vision Dental 401(K) Bonus And More!
